We expected to use high-density microarray (Affymetrix) to analyzethe expression profiles of pancreas development. We generatedtranscriptional profiles of pancreatic tissue isolated from five biologicallysignificant stages of development: embryonic day (E) 12.5, E15.5, E18.5,newborn and adult pancreas. These analyses implicated that many genesrelated with pancreatic function were enriched in the later gestation whenislet architecture and function are gradually forming. The differentialexpression of paxillin mRNA was verified by RT-PCR. Moreover, thedifferential expression of paxillin protein was identified by westernblotting, with different expression profile against mRNA. Paxillinlocalized both in islets and exocrine pancreas, which was detected byimmunohistochemistry. Our present preliminary evidence suggested thatpaxillin might play roles in maintaining islet structure and function,especially in islet remodeling after birth.
